Andrew Walker and Rachel Boston Bring Passion to New Hallmark Romance
Hallmark Channel’s heating things up this fall with its latest romantic comedy, Adventures in Love and Birding. This one stars the always-charming Rachel Boston and Andrew Walker—honestly, you can’t go wrong with those two.
The film’s inspired by Sarah T. Dubb’s novel Birding With Benefits. It promises laughter, heart, and, well, maybe a bit more kissing than you’d expect from a Hallmark flick.

Boston and Walker have been friends forever, and it shows. This time, their chemistry really takes off—reuniting after seven years apart, they’re out to prove that even a birdwatching story can turn unexpectedly passionate.

The Sweet Science Behind the Kisses
If you’re a Hallmark fan, you know the network’s not exactly famous for steamy scenes. But Adventures in Love and Birding edges closer to that line—in the best possible way.
Andrew Walker admitted this is the most kissing he’s ever done in a Hallmark movie, but it never feels forced. He and Boston tackled the romantic scenes with a mix of professionalism and a good sense of humor.
They treated each kiss as its own little story beat—trying to make every moment feel honest, not just another take. Their history helps; these two first worked together 16 years ago on ER, so there’s a lot of trust there.
That comfort let them get into the nitty-gritty of each scene, right down to the tilt of a head or a hand placement. At one point, they even joked about studying “the anatomy of a kiss” just to keep things looking natural.
Walker says being open and willing to experiment made things less awkward and way more creative. Boston felt the same, pointing out that these moments are about two people finding themselves through love—not just the physical stuff.
When Chemistry Meets Craft
Their rapport is easy and believable. Walker calls Boston “open, grounded, and refreshingly fearless” in romance scenes.
Boston saw the story as a chance to play with vulnerability and the idea of second chances. Her character, Celeste, is learning to embrace life again after years of playing it safe.
Both actors credit their long friendship for letting them push creative boundaries, while still keeping it light and respectful.
From Birding to Bonding: A Love Story With Feathers
So what’s the story? Celeste, a single mom, gets roped into teaming up with John, a bird enthusiast, for a local birding competition.
Things take a turn when Celeste accidentally introduces herself as John’s girlfriend instead of just his teammate. Suddenly, they have to keep up the charade—and that’s when things get interesting.
At a party with Celeste’s friends, John realizes they’ll have to act like a real couple to keep up appearances. That leads to one of Hallmark’s most talked-about kissing scenes—maybe ever.
Walker called it “hot and heavy by Hallmark standards,” but it’s also funny and full of heart. The kiss isn’t just for show; it’s a big turning point for both characters.
For Celeste, it’s about stepping out of her comfort zone. For John, it’s a reminder that love can show up when you’re least expecting it.
The film uses birding as a metaphor for life’s surprises—sometimes, you just have to slow down and really look to see what’s right in front of you.

Behind the Scenes: Friendship, Family, and Fun
Off camera, Boston and Walker’s friendship is just as genuine as what you see on screen. They’ve known each other for over 15 years, and that easy camaraderie makes working together a breeze.
They’ve both grown a lot, personally and professionally, since their early days. That maturity comes through in their approach to storytelling.
Walker admits it’s always a bit weird to kiss someone who’s not his wife, but his respect for Boston and their shared professionalism made it comfortable—maybe even fun.
Boston became a mom not too long ago and often brings her daughter, Grace, to set. She loves showing her little one what it looks like to chase your passion and still keep family front and center.
For Boston, working in family entertainment isn’t just a job—it fits her values. She talks about sharing lunch breaks with Grace and letting her see that “mommy loves what she does.”
Walker’s Family Joins the Fun
Walker’s two sons, West and Wolf, also made appearances on set, turning filming days into family adventures. He’s quick to praise Boston for her dedication as both an actress and a mom.
Watching her with her daughter inspired him. Their shared focus on family deepened their bond on set, which is probably why their performances ring so true.

The Final Takeaway
When Adventures in Love and Birding premieres on September 27, 2025, viewers can expect more than just another cozy romance. It’s something a little different—two seasoned actors at the top of their game, and a story that’s all about second chances.
It’s a reminder that love—like birding—takes patience, curiosity, and a willingness to take flight. Available the next day on Hallmark+, this film feels poised to become a fan favorite, mixing humor, heart, and just the right touch of heat.
